I recently picked up a Daisy model 25 manufactured in Plymouth, Michigan that I’m pretty sure is around a 1936 model. The air tube was missing and the leather seals were deteriorated. I ordered a new air tube assembly and leather seals from JG Airguns. I haven’t received them yet but the description said to oil the leather seals prior to installing them. What is the best way to do this? Soak them over night or a few drops as I reassemble? Also, I have always used 20W oil in my other Daisy’s, will this be fine for these leather seals as well?
